构建一个行数为1,列数为5的dataframe
时间: 2024-05-14 17:12:32 浏览: 78
可以使用Pandas库中的DataFrame函数来构建一个行数为1,列数为5的DataFrame:
```python
import pandas as pd
df = pd.DataFrame(columns=['col1', 'col2', 'col3', 'col4', 'col5'])
```
这个DataFrame中没有任何数据,只有列名。可以通过添加数据来填充DataFrame。
相关问题
构建一个行数为1,列数为10的dataframe
可以使用如下代码构建一个行数为1,列数为10的DataFrame:
```
import pandas as pd
data = pd.DataFrame([range(10)])
print(data)
```
输出结果:
```
0 1 2 3 4 5 6 7 8 9
0 0 1 2 3 4 5 6 7 8 9
```
其中,`[range(10)]`是一个列表,包含了从0到9的整数。这个列表被作为数据传递给了`pd.DataFrame()`函数,该函数将其转换为DataFrame。由于列表中只有一个元素,因此DataFrame的行数为1。由于这个元素是一个包含10个整数的列表,因此DataFrame的列数为10。
构建dataframe R语言
在R语言中,可以使用data.frame()函数来构建dataframe数据。data.frame()函数接受多个参数,每个参数代表一个列向量,这些列向量将组成数据框的列。每个列向量的长度必须相同,否则会出错。下面是一个构建dataframe的示例代码:
```
# 创建列向量
symbols <- c("MSFT", "KO", "CSCO")
price <- c(40.40, 40.56, 23.02)
currency <- rep("USD", 3)
country <- rep("USA", 3)
type <- rep("STOCK", 3)
# 构建dataframe
df <- data.frame(symbols, price, currency, country, type)
# 打印dataframe的类别
print(class(df))
# 打印dataframe的行数和列数
cat("df数据框行数为:", nrow(df), "\ndf数据框列数为:", ncol(df), "\n", sep="")
# 打印dataframe的总元素数量
cat("df数据框总元素数量为:", length(df), "\n", sep="")
```
这段代码首先创建了几个列向量,然后使用data.frame()函数将这些列向量组合成一个dataframe。最后,使用print()函数打印dataframe的类别,使用cat()函数打印dataframe的行数、列数和总元素数量。
#### 引用[.reference_title]
- *1* *2* [R语言通过多个向量vector数据创建dataframe数据](https://blog.csdn.net/omhdxgb/article/details/123292193)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insertT0,239^v3^insert_chatgpt"}} ] [.reference_item]
- *3* [R语言入门(9)-数据结构之数据框(dataframe)](https://blog.csdn.net/m0_52406014/article/details/122593721)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insertT0,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]
阅读全文